If your water pipe freezes, switch on the nearest faucet tap to that pipe so that water can exit when the pipe thaws. This reduces pressure to keep the pipe from bursting, which could prevent a big mess in your home.

Never pay a plumber until the job is complete. A plumber might ask you for part of the money before starting the job but you should never pay more than half. This ensures that the plumber fully completes the job before getting paid.

You should make sure not to put oils down the drain, such as grease and fat. When these oils cool, they become hard and create clogs. As an owner of a garbage disposal, this is important because the blades will stop working if they have fat on them. Pour the grease and oil into a can to cool, put it in the trash.

If your house uses well water and there are orange or pink stains in tubs or sinks, it's because of the iron level in the water. This is something that needs to be taken care of by water softener, which you can buy at a store, or have a company come out to your house and take care of it for you.

If you have multiple plumbing problems, schedule all of them to be fixed together. You might be tempted to contact a plumber every time you face a small problem, but if you have problems repaired all at once, you will have time to save money for the fixes. Most plumbers charge an hourly fee that can be minimized if there is only one visit to your home.

Pour baking soda and vinegar down your bathtub drain every month. Cover the drain with a plug or rag as you wait for the chemical reaction between the vinegar and baking soda to happen in your pipes. Wait for a little while and then allow boiling water to go down the drain. This procedure will clear the hair and soap scum out of your pipes.

Be sure to regularly clean out the lint trap that is in your dryer. By doing this simple task, you can circumvent a great deal of trouble. including prevention of fires. See to it that you look at the lint trap and find out if it has tears or holes in it that could cause lint to go inside your pipes. This could lead to clogs or other problems in the future.
